Since joining Spurs back in November 2021, Antonio Conte has done superbly to guide his new side to fourth place in the Premier League, crucially earning them Champions League qualification for 2022/23 after two years away from the European competition. Tottenham achieved the feat on the final day of the Premier League, with an emphatic 5-0 win over Norwich enough to pip north London rivals Arsenal to fourth place. With Champions League qualification now secured, Conte can now look forward to improving his side further with summer reinforcements, and Spurs have backed the Italian with a £150million investment for the upcoming window.
